DIAGONALE 2007,
the Festival of Austrian Film
Every year towards the end of March, observers of the Austrian film
business notice a movement of Austrian filmmakers - sort of a migration
- to the south of the country. As in past years, the DIAGONALE, the
festival of Austrian Film, again attempted in Graz an annual meeting
of the Austrian film landscape.
From March 19 th to 25 th , already for the tenth time, the Diagonale 07, took place in the small and pleasant town of Graz , where a review of Austrian films, which were produced during the last year, were presented and some of them awarded.
Again two awards have been endowed by the Austrian Association of Cinematographers AAC: Best cinematography feature film and Best cinematography documentary .
Nominated were all feature length Austrian films or documentaries, which have been presented in the programme of the Diagonale 07. The juries of the Diagonale Award (feature film) and the Main Diagonale Award (documentary) also selected the recipients for the best camerawork.
This year the jury of the Diagonale Award (feature film) consisted of Florian Flicker (director, AUT), Florian Koerner (Producer, GER) and Linda Soeffker (curator Berlinale, GER): "The Award Best Cinematography Feature Film 2006/07 goes to Bernhard Keller and the film FALLEN from Barbara Albert. Excitingly etched images and lighting that fits the mood. The camera is close enough but at the right distance."
Martina Kudlácek (filmmaker, AUT), Micha Schiwow (Swiss Films, CH) and Gudrun Sommer (Duisburger Filmwoche, GER) were in the jury of the Main Diagonale Award (documentary), which gave the prize to Jo Molitoris for IT HAPPENED JUST BEFORE from Anja Salomonowitz : " We want to award the camerawork, which visualizes a subtile filmic concept. Because of a consequent framing and placement of colours, an alienation of the documentary image is achieved."
